This PR moves the Glimmerfold consent banner from 10% to staged full rollout. Changes: region-aware pacing, a kill switch honored within one poll cycle, and tighter retry behavior on the config fetch. On-call: if error rates climb, flip the kill switch first and ask questions later — the banner fails closed. The pacing and retry constants this PR ships are below.

tuning table, hafog-bahaf:
QUOTAS = {
    "praion": 144,
    "briax": 906,
    "silwyn": 451,
}

Welcome to the Lanternleaf consent banner program. Plugin authors must register each banner variant before rollout so the Driftgate compliance checker can validate copy, locale coverage, and dismissal behavior. Please test against the staging consent ledger rather than production; consent records are immutable once written, and malformed entries cannot be purged without a formal review. To connect your local plugin harness to the staging ledger, configure your client with the connection string below.

replica DSN, hadug-yajep: postgresql://aldiel_svc:W4u8z42Jo5IFtG@db-1656.torvacorp.local:5432/holael

## Reminder job overview

The Medrow appointment reminder job runs nightly and sends SMS and email notices for visits scheduled within the next 72 hours at the Fernhollow clinic network. It reads from the scheduling replica, never the primary, and skips patients flagged as contact-restricted. Failures retry three times with backoff before landing in the dead-letter queue, which the morning rotation reviews. If the job overruns its 40-minute window, check replica lag first. It runs with these settings.

service settings:
HOLDOR_PIN=6477
HOLDOR_METRICS_HOST=metrics.holdor.nelvrocorp.corp
HOLDOR_LOG_LEVEL=error
HOLDOR_TENANT=noviel

Onboarding — Examrill Proctoring Queue (contractors)

Welcome aboard. The proctoring queue assigns live exam sessions to reviewers in priority order: flagged sessions first, then scheduled checks. You'll work in the staging tenant for your first two weeks; nothing there touches real candidates. Please read the escalation matrix before claiming any flagged session. Your staging workstation ships locked, and first sign-in asks you to enter the recovery passphrase provided below.

vault phrase of bafop-kahop = sormir-frador